The people working with radioactive materials should put on special

  1. iron lined aprons and copper gloves.

  2. silver lined aprons and silver gloves.

  3. lead lined aprons and lead gloves

  4. any of the above can be used.


Correct Option: C
Explanation:

The people working with radioactive naturals are required to follow strictly the safety rules like they should put on special lead lined aprons and lead gloves. They should handle the radioactive naturals with long lead tongs.

The visible light spectrum of a typical star like our Sun shows:

  1. bright emission lines

  2. shows all of the other answers depending on the season on Earth

  3. no spectral lines at all

  4. dark absorption lines


Correct Option: D
Explanation:

They show dark absorption light which tells us about the temperature of star like oxide lines are there only in cool stars while hot stars show helium lines.

Which type of eclipse is known when Earth, Moon and Sun doesn't align in straight line and Moon only partially covers sun?

  1. Total Solar Eclipse

  2. Partial Solar Eclipse

  3. Annular Solar Eclipse

  4. None


Correct Option: B
Explanation:

When Moon is between the Sun and the Earth but doesn't align in a straight line results in a partial solar eclipse.

Partial Solar Eclipse is known when Earth, Moon and Sun doesn't align in straight line and Moon only partially covers sun.
